Voting from Page 1 thin Lead in Texas Over Jackson and Gephardt who were lied for second there. But Dukakis had a Strong Lead in Florida As Well As Back Home in Massachusetts and Rhode Island. Overall in the dozen Southern states with Prima Ries Bush led Bob Dole 60 percent to 20 percent followed by Pat Robertson Ai 12 percent and Jack Kemp at 4 percent with 4 percent undecided. Abc news said the figures for the entire South were somewhat misleading because the two largest states Texas and Florida make up a Large share of the Vole. It said Jackson led in most of the deep South with Gore the Tennessee senator running second. Jackson s strongest leads were in Alabama and Mississippi where nearly halt the voters polled said they support him. He also led in Arkansas Georgia Louisi Ana North Carolina and Virginia and was second i Tennessee behind Gore second in Florida and Mary land behind Dukakis and tied for second with of Finardi in Texas. Dukakis led in Florida Maryland Massachusetts Rhode Island and Texas appeared to be headed for second in Virginia behind Jackson and was in tight Battles for second with Gore in Arkansas Louisiana and North Carolina. Core had Strong leads in Tennessee and Kentucky and a thin Edge in Oklahoma where Abc said Gep Hardt was running Only slightly behind Gephardt was ahead in the poll Only in Missouri and second just behind Gore in Oklahoma and second Tagore in Kentucky Gephardt and Jackson were tied behind Dukakis m Texas. Abc said he was running fourth in Mast of he other states and was in danger of falling below the 15 percent threshold for delegates in a dozen of the 16 primary states. Abc said Bush s 60-20 Lead Over Dole Region wide to paced by Bush s Strong showings in Texas and Florida. Bush was the Choice of about 40 percent of those polled in Missouri and 70 percent in Tai.
